🛠️ Engine & Performance
The Yamaha MT-15 shares its engine with the legendary Yamaha R15 V4, meaning you’re getting track-ready performance in a street-focused package.
- Engine: 155cc, single-cylinder, liquid-cooled, SOHC
- Maximum Power: 18.4 PS @ 10,000 rpm
- Maximum Torque: 14.1 Nm @ 7,500 rpm
- Transmission: 6-speed gearbox
- Assist & Slipper Clutch: Yes
- Variable Valve Actuation (VVA): Yes
- Top Speed: Around 135–140 km/h
Thanks to VVA, the MT-15 V2 offers strong low-end torque for city rides and impressive top-end pull for highway sprints. It’s light, quick, and perfect for aggressive riding.
⛽ Mileage & Fuel Efficiency
Despite its sporty engine, the MT-15 is surprisingly fuel-efficient, making it practical for everyday use.
- Claimed Mileage: 45–50 km/l
- Real-World Mileage: 40–45 km/l
- Fuel Tank Capacity: 10 liters
- Riding Range: 400–450 km per full tank
This makes it one of the most fuel-efficient performance-oriented bikes in its class.

⚙️ Features & Technology
The MT-15 V2 packs a smart mix of performance features and modern tech, ensuring both thrill and control.
- ✅ Digital LCD Instrument Cluster
- ✅ Bluetooth Connectivity (Y-Connect App) – shows call/SMS alerts, last park location, fuel consumption data
- ✅ Assist & Slipper Clutch – smoother downshifts
- ✅ Upside-Down Front Forks (USD) – improved handling
- ✅ Deltabox Frame – ensures excellent rigidity and cornering
- ✅ Side Stand Engine Cut-off for added safety
- ✅ LED Lighting for headlamp and tail section
While it doesn’t have a TFT display or quickshifter like the R15, the MT-15 keeps its focus on core performance and street usability.
🪑 Comfort & Ride Quality
The MT-15 offers a comfortable, upright riding posture, which makes it easier to ride in traffic and for longer commutes compared to the aggressive R15 stance.
- Seat Height: 810 mm
- Kerb Weight: Just 141 kg – one of the lightest in the segment
- Suspension: 37mm USD forks (front), Monoshock (rear)
- Ergonomics: Upright handlebars, slightly rear-set footpegs
It’s nimble, flickable, and fun, whether you’re lane-splitting or attacking corners on twisty roads.
🛑 Braking & Safety
- Front Brake: 282 mm Disc
- Rear Brake: 220 mm Disc
- ABS: Single-channel ABS
- Tyres: MRF / Metzeler (depending on variant) – Radial at rear
- Wheels: 17-inch alloy wheels
While dual-channel ABS would’ve been ideal, the MT-15’s braking setup is still sharp and responsive, especially for skilled riders.
💰 Price & Variants
Yamaha MT-15 V2 is available in standard and MotoGP editions, with identical mechanicals and features.
- Ex-Showroom Price (Delhi): ₹1.68 lakh – ₹1.73 lakh
- On-Road Price: ₹1.90 lakh – ₹2.05 lakh (varies by location)
It’s one of the best-priced performance streetfighters in the 150–160cc segment considering the engine, build, and tech on offer.

🔄 Competitors
The Yamaha MT-15 competes with:
- TVS Apache RTR 160 4V – More value-focused but less aggressive
- Bajaj Pulsar N160 – Slightly more powerful, lacks VVA refinement
- KTM Duke 125 / 200 – More premium but much pricier
- Suzuki Gixxer 155 – Smooth and refined but not as exciting
Still, MT-15 wins in engine refinement, performance-to-weight ratio, and sporty design.
